Mission

We are looking for a Network Administrator to maintain a reliable, secure and efficient data communications network. The ideal candidate will be able to deploy, configure, maintain and monitor all active network equipment in order to ensure smooth network operation. Our Network Administrator will also have to provide remote support to our clients.

Responsibilities

  • Fully support, configure, maintain and upgrade corporate customer’s networks and in house servers
  • Install and integrate new server hardware and applications
  • Keep an eye out for needed updates
  • Support and administer third-party applications
  • Ensure network security and connectivity
  • Monitor network performance (availability, utilization, throughput, goodput, and latency) and test for weaknesses
  • Set up user accounts, permissions and passwords
  • Resolve problems reported by end users
  • Research and make recommendations on server system administration
  • Provide remote support to our clients

Requirements

  • Proven experience in a network administrator role (2+ years)
  • Hands on experience in networking, routing and switching
  • Excellent knowledge of best practices around management, control, and monitoring of server infrastructure
  • Experience with firewalls, Internet VPN’s remote implementation, troubleshooting, and problem resolution is desired
  • Ability to set up and configure server hardware
  • Familiarity with backup and recovery software and methodologies
  • Great at organizing, prioritizing and multitasking
  • Juniper, Cisco, CWNA or BCNE training
  • Fluent in English and french
